TimkenSteel sees continued weakness in 2016

Specialty steelmaker TimkenSteel expects 2016 to be another choppy year for the industry, Kallanish learns from the company’s quarterly earnings outlook. "While we continue to feel the impact from weak global commodity markets and high customer inventory levels, our cost reduction efforts and pace of new business from innovation reduced the losses we anticipated in the quarter," says ceo Tim Timken.
